The Saudi Ministry of Defense is hosting military attachés for Hajj

Introduction: The efforts of the Saudi Ministry of Defense during the Hajj season

The Saudi Ministry of Defense, represented by the International Cooperation Department within the General Directorate of Policies and Strategies at the Ministry's Agency for Strategic Affairs, announced the completion of all preparations to host military attachés accredited to the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ia for this year's Hajj pilgrimage. This important step is part of the annual program dedicated to hosting military delegations and leaders from various countries around the world, reflecting the military establishment's commitment to actively participating in serving the pilgrims.

An integrated system of logistical services in the holy sites

The International Cooperation Department oversees the direct and meticulous implementation of the Hajj hosting program, coordinating all organizational and administrative aspects. This begins with arrival and reception arrangements at entry points, continues through the smooth and easy movement of pilgrims to the holy sites, and extends to the completion of the Hajj rituals. To ensure the comfort of the pilgrims, the Ministry has allocated fully equipped camps with the latest technology in Mina. These camps have been designed to provide the highest levels of comfort and services, including premium accommodation, modern transportation, and comprehensive medical care, supported by a comprehensive 24/7 logistical and technical support system.
